Scoring Points with the Boss

Clearly a believer in making work fun, Dr. Levine's NEAT desk stands near an elongated space. When his assistants want to discuss an idea with him, they both grab hockey sticks and fire rubber balls at a wall target as they talk.

Dr. Levine says his NEAT office can be modified to any work need and easily constructed in a short time. He says the cost of the changeover will be paid many times over by the benefits of a healthier staff.
